Topographical correspondence between convolutional layers of DCNNs and human ventral visual regions. For each brain-model mapping (EVC, Fusiform, IT, PHC), the first five maps show the correlational topographical maps between each convolutional layer and the brain ROI; the second five maps show the corresponding significance maps (two-sided sign permutation tests, cluster defining threshold P < 0.01, and corrected significance level P < 0.05). The topographical correlation maps in this figure are computed following the method depicted in Fig. 2. For detailed description of RDM computations and correlations please see the Method section.
